Output 578833ebc35bfaf0e18260b95fd8a48809b953a52b6db7e8dfa67e40f11ac8a0:0

value
1851
script pubkey
OP_0 OP_PUSHBYTES_20 baf95bd66f607ef65d232fed8f66e3f308413431
address
bc1qhtu4h4n0vpl0vhfr9lkc7ehr7vyyzdp388fqyj
transaction
578833ebc35bfaf0e18260b95fd8a48809b953a52b6db7e8dfa67e40f11ac8a0